Ben Best Dies: ‘Eastbound & Down’ Co-Creator And ‘The Foot Fist Way’ Writer And Co-Star Was 46
Ben Best, an actor and writer who penned and co-starred alongside Danny McBride the cult indie pic The Foot Fist Way and later co-created, wrote and appeared with McBride in the HBO comedy series Eastbound & Down, died Sunday. He was 46.

‘Eastbound & Down’ Finale Hits High
Self-obsessed and self-destructive Kenny Powers went out on top in the end. The final episode of HBO's comedy Eastbound & Down pulled in 899,000 viewers on Sunday at 10PM. HBO Ends ‘Eastbound & Down’ With Season 4; ‘Boardwalk Empire’, Larry David’s ‘Clear History’ & ‘Hello Ladies’ Premieres Set
HBO said today that Eastbound & Down’s upcoming fourth season will be its last. The previously announced eight-episode Season 4 of self-obsessed and self-destructive baseball player Kenny Powers, starring Danny McBride, will debut September 29.
